Job Summary
Senior associates primarily responsible for hands‑on project execution, with specialization in one or more service lines. Associates are assigned to a service delivery principal who supervises their career development, and daily activities are closely supervised by project management teams. Senior associates may supervise other associates or senior associates as part of a project management team. Continuous learning is promoted, with a requirement to attend at least one ISO conference or training event per year.
